Output 59637ed45d8a0b539cd75bd54df37933fe54b28d60c73920b1470a8f626316c1:0

value
3022500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58da9ec7664cf41d41e1e78879a8ff55530e5185 OP_EQUAL
address
39nqHRazvwubSsSy3hYZdwrANVDPdxkSTH
transaction
59637ed45d8a0b539cd75bd54df37933fe54b28d60c73920b1470a8f626316c1
confirmations
305400
spent
true